Why Live in North Kansas City

North Kansas City, Missouri, is a small city located just across the Missouri River from downtown Kansas City. Known for its vibrant and artistic community, North Kansas City blends urban, suburban, and industrial elements. The area is home to numerous locally owned eateries and shops, particularly along Armour Road, where establishments like Chappell's Restaurant & Sports Museum and the Iron District offer unique dining and shopping experiences. The city spans 4 square miles and hosts over 1,000 businesses, most of which are family-owned. Housing options include bungalows with Craftsman elements, ranch-style homes, and newer townhouses, with larger apartment complexes developing rapidly. Community parks such as William E. Macken Park, Waggin' Trail Dog Park, and Dagg Park provide recreational opportunities, while ROKC caters to climbers and adventure seekers. The North Kansas City 74 School District serves local students, with Briarcliff Elementary School, Northgate Middle School, and North Kansas City High School all receiving high ratings. The high school is celebrated for its diversity, with over 160 languages spoken. The city is highly walkable and offers strong public transportation options, making it easy to reach downtown Kansas City within 10 minutes. For those looking for things to do, North Kansas City offers a mix of dining, shopping, and outdoor activities, all within a community that is safer than the national average.

Is it more affordable to rent or buy in North Kansas City, MO?
In North Kansas City, MO, the price-to-rent ratio is 44.5, which generally favors renting. This ratio divides the median home price by the annual median rent: below 15 typically favors buying, 15 to 20 is balanced, and above 20 typically favors renting. Your finances, how long you plan to stay, and costs like mortgage rates, taxes, and maintenance all factor into the decision.
